Job Background/context:

Citi Private Bank is a trusted advisor to the world’s wealthiest, most influential individuals and families. Like Citi’s government, institutional and multinational corporate clients, Citi Private Bank clients receive bespoke service and access to the best ideas and solutions tailored to their unique needs and aspirations. A part of Citi’s Institutional Clients Group, Citi Private Bank offers a wide range of products and services covering capital markets, managed investments, portfolio management, trust and estate planning, investment finance and banking. Among its select clients are a third of the world’s billionaires, many of whom are globally minded entrepreneurs with an expectation of an institutional level of service, who take advantage of Citi’s holistic approach to wealth management.

Citi Private Bank is represented by more than 1,000 private bankers, investment professionals and product specialists across a network of 90 offices in 33 countries and over 128 currencies worldwide, making it the most global private bank.
